Job description
Ontology Design & Development:
- Lead the full ontology lifecycle supporting a defined project scope: requirements gathering, conceptual modeling, formal specification (OWL 2, RDFS, SKOS), validation, and deployment
- Design T-Box (schema) structures and contribute to A-Box (instance) hydration patterns across structured and unstructured data sources
- Apply and uphold established naming conventions, URI strategies, and modular ontology architecture principles
- Apply advanced modeling patterns where appropriate (e.g., reification, n-ary relations, punning) in consultation with senior team members
- Create and evolve ontologies, taxonomies, and vocabularies using standards including OWL, RDF, RDFS, and SKOS
- Map traditional data structures (e.g., relational databases) into semantic frameworks
- Build and maintain knowledge graphs to support reasoning, discovery, and advanced analytics
- Ensure models align with business goals, regulatory requirements, and data governance practices
- Coach the business (SMEs and stakeholders) in developing and validating competency questions to guide and test ontology scope and correctness
- Maintain awareness of relevant upper ontologies (e.g., BFO, schema.org) and apply alignment patterns as appropriate
Stakeholder Engagement:
- Facilitate business SME workshops with BA support to elicit domain concepts, relationships, and competency questions
- Translate ambiguous business language into precise, machine-readable semantics
- Communicate modeling decisions to non-technical stakeholders in accessible terms
- Support feedback loops between business validation and ontology iteration
Technical Contribution:
- Apply ontology governance standards: version control, change management, and quality gates (W3C compliance, SHACL/ShEx validation)
- Define and enforce Definition of Done criteria for ontology deliverables in collaboration with the senior team
- Apply R2RML / RML mapping strategies for structured data integration
- Collaborate with Entity Extraction / NLP teams on ontology-guided information extraction from unstructured sources
- Collaborate with knowledge graph hydration, testing, and validation against competency questions

We are seeking an experienced Knowledge Modeler / Ontologist to contribute to domain ontology design, governance, and delivery for enterprise knowledge graph initiatives. Working collaboratively within a team and under the guidance of an ontology governance framework, this role bridges business stakeholders, data engineering, and AI/ML teams - translating complex business domains into rigorous, standards-compliant semantic models that power intelligent applications., * Ontology Engineering: Proficiency in OWL 2, RDF, RDFS, SKOS, SHACL, and SPARQL for building and validating semantic models
- Semantic Web Standards: Working knowledge of W3C standards and best practices for linked data and knowledge representation
- Knowledge Graph Development: Experience designing and querying knowledge graphs using tools such as GraphDB, Stardog, or Neo4j
- Tooling: Hands-on experience with ontology authoring tools such as Protégé or Ontotext
- Data Integration: Familiarity with R2RML or RML for mapping relational or semi-structured sources into semantic models
- Competency Question Development: Ability to formulate and use competency questions to scope, validate, and iterate on ontological models
- Upper Ontology Awareness: Familiarity with upper ontologies such as BFO, DOLCE, or schema.org and their role in interoperability
- Communication & Collaboration: Ability to translate complex technical concepts into business-friendly language and engage effectively with both technical and non-technical stakeholders
